OpenTK.DisplayDevice Class

Defines a display device on the underlying system, and provides methods to query and change its display parameters.

public class DisplayDevice


Namespace: OpenTK
Assembly: OpenTK-1.0 (in OpenTK-1.0.dll)
The members of OpenTK.DisplayDevice are listed below.

Public Properties

AvailableDisplaysIList<DisplayDevice>. Gets the list of available DisplayDevice objects.
AvailableResolutionsIList<DisplayResolution>. Gets the list of DisplayResolution objects available on this device.
BitsPerPixelInt32. Gets a System.Int32 that contains number of bits per pixel of this display. Typical values include 8, 16, 24 and 32.
BoundsRectangle. Gets the bounds of this instance in pixel coordinates..
DefaultDisplayDevice. Gets the default (primary) display of this system.
HeightInt32. Gets a System.Int32 that contains the height of this display in pixels.
IsPrimaryBoolean. Gets a System.Boolean that indicates whether this Display is the primary Display in systems with multiple Displays.
RefreshRateSingle. Gets a System.Single representing the vertical refresh rate of this display.
WidthInt32. Gets a System.Int32 that contains the width of this display in pixels.

Public Methods

Changes the resolution of the DisplayDevice.
ChangeResolution(Int32, Int32, Int32, Single)
Changes the resolution of the DisplayDevice.
Restores the original resolution of the DisplayDevice.
SelectResolution(Int32, Int32, Int32, Single) : DisplayResolution
Selects an available resolution that matches the specified parameters.
ToString() : String
Returns a System.String representing this DisplayDevice.